Modernization of e-learning platforms towards a service-oriented architecture

被引:0
|
作者
Seridi, Ali [1 ,2 ]
Dib, Lynda [1 ]
Bourbia, Riad [1 ,2 ]
机构
[1] Badji Mokhtar Univ, Dept Comp Sci, Annaba, Algeria
[2] Univ 8 Mai 1945 Guelma, Labst Lab, Guelma, Algeria
关键词
E-learning; Service Oriented Architecture; Service based e-learning platforms; Web service;
D O I
暂无
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
An e-learning platform according to the point of view of service-oriented architecture (SOA,) is considered as a set of services that cooperate nth each other to provide a set of functionalities to the actors of the platform. Once, one or several functionalities are exposed as a service, they become ready to be used locally and reused by other external learning platforms. Such an approach would save a lot of effort, cost and implementation time. Our objective through this work is to modernize e-learning platforms that are developed in technologies that are becoming increasingly obsolete (legacy system) through a new technology (SOA) that enables continuous and progressive evolution. To achieve this, we conducted an analysis phase of the various existing e-learning platforms. This allowed us to identify and bring out a set of services that could be shared and reused by e-learning systems. In order to provide quality services, we have conducted our identification process in such a way as to meet the essential criteria of the SOA, namely autonomy, statelessness, loose coupling with external parties and strong internal cohesion. An experimental phase allowed us to test web services that have been implemented with different programming languages and hosted in different servers. Test results have enabled us to validate our approach and our choices.
引用
收藏
页码:123 / 132
页数:10
相关论文
共 50 条
  • [1] Modernization of e-learning platforms towards a service-oriented architecture
    Seridi, Ali
    Dib, Lynda
    Bourbia, Riad
    [J]. Journal of Electrical Systems, 2019, 15 (01): : 123 - 132
  • [2] A Survey on Service-Oriented Architecture for E-Learning System
    Rani, Jamuna S.
    Ashok, Marie Stanislas
    [J]. IAMA: 2009 INTERNATIONAL CONFERENCE ON INTELLIGENT AGENT & MULTI-AGENT SYSTEMS, 2009, : 313 - +
  • [3] Towards a Service-Oriented e-Learning Framework Based on Semantics
    Bianchini, Devis
    De Antonellis, Valeria
    De Nicola, Antonio
    Missikoff, Michele
    [J]. PROCEEDINGS OF THE 8TH EUROPEAN CONFERENCE ON E-LEARNING, 2009, : 81 - 90
  • [4] Service-oriented e-Learning system
    Su, Moon Ting
    Wong, Chee Shyang
    Soo, Chuak Fen
    Ooi, Choon Tsun
    Sow, Shun Ling
    [J]. PROCEEDINGS OF THE 2007 1ST INTERNATIONAL SYMPOSIUM ON INFORMATION TECHNOLOGIES AND APPLICATIONS IN EDUCATION (ISITAE 2007), 2007, : 6 - 11
  • [5] A multiagent and service-oriented architecture for developing adaptive e-learning systems
    Lin, Fuhua
    Holt, Peter
    Leung, Steve
    Li, Qin
    [J]. INTERNATIONAL JOURNAL OF CONTINUING ENGINEERING EDUCATION AND LIFE-LONG LEARNING, 2006, 16 (1-2) : 77 - 91
  • [6] E-learning Ecosystem Based on Service-Oriented Cloud Computing Architecture
    Lohmosavi, Vajihe
    Nejad, Akbar Farhoodi
    Hosseini, Elham Morad
    [J]. 2013 5TH CONFERENCE ON INFORMATION AND KNOWLEDGE TECHNOLOGY (IKT), 2013, : 24 - 29
  • [7] Service-oriented grid architecture and middleware technologies for collaborative e-learning
    Wang, GL
    Li, YS
    Yang, SW
    Miao, CY
    Xu, J
    Shi, ML
    [J]. 2005 IEEE INTERNATIONAL CONFERENCE ON SERVICES COMPUTING , VOL 2, PROCEEDINGS, 2005, : 67 - 74
  • [8] Building Flexible Service-Oriented E-Learning Platforms Base on Information Networks
    Liu, Yong-Min
    Fu, Hong-Jun
    Huang, Wei-Dong
    [J]. EDUCATION AND EDUCATION MANAGEMENT, 2011, 1 : 281 - +
  • [9] Service-oriented e-learning platforms - From monolithic systems to flexible services
    Dagger, Declan
    O'Connor, Alexander
    Lawless, Seamus
    Walsh, Eddie
    Wade, Vincent P.
    [J]. IEEE INTERNET COMPUTING, 2007, 11 (03) : 28 - 35
  • [10] Personalized Service-Oriented E-Learning Environments
    Munoz-Organero, Mario
    Munoz-Merino, Pedro J.
    Delgado Kloos, Carlos
    [J]. IEEE INTERNET COMPUTING, 2010, 14 (02) : 62 - 67